The click-clack mechanism on my current sofa bed is my favorite piece of engineering in the entire apartment. It replaced a previous sofa that required lifting the heavy seat cushion and wrestling with a metal bar that always pinched my fingers. The click-clack style is simpler. You sit on the edge, pull the seat forward, and the backrest drops flush with the seat. The gap is minimal, maybe the thickness of a blanket. I added a foam mattress topper that bridges the seam and guests tell me they sleep better on that sofa bed than on my actual bed. The mechanism itself is built into the frame so there are no loose parts to lose. Just a clean click and you have a flat sleeping surface. I used to think velvet upholstery was impractical for a bedroom because of dust and pet hair. Then I bought a secondhand sofa bed in teal velvet and changed my mind. The fabric is so dense that crumbs and hair sit on the surface instead of sinking into the weave. A quick pass with a lint roller and it looks brand new. Plus velvet does not show wrinkles like linen and does not pill like cheap polyester. My cat has scratched the armrest exactly once and the marks barely show. If you are afraid of velvet, try a performance grade fabric with a high rub count. But honestly, the softness of velvet makes a small bedroom feel more like a cozy den than a cramped box. The biggest game changer for me was switching to a bed with storage. I used to stuff extra blankets and winter sweaters into plastic bins that lived under the bed, but those bins slid out constantly and collected dust bunnies like they were precious artifacts. Then I found a platform frame with drawers built into the base. The plywood drawers glide on metal tracks and each one holds four bulky sweaters or two sets of sheets. No more bending over to fish for a pillowcase at midnight.
